Latanoprost Market Size
The Latanoprost market was valued at USD 1,437.85 million in 2024 and is expected to reach USD 1,469.48 million in 2025, growing to USD 1,748.9 million by 2033. This reflects a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 2.2% over the forecast period from 2025 to 2033.
The U.S. Latanoprost market is driven by increasing glaucoma cases, an aging population, and advancements in ophthalmic treatments. Steady growth is expected through 2033, supported by strong healthcare infrastructure and rising demand for effective eye care solutions.
